About the role
The Administrative Specialist 1 role within the NYS HELPS program supports the Eligibility Systems Modernization Group, providing professional administrative and technical support across three bureaus. Responsibilities include coordinating the Group Director's meetings, travel arrangements, and keeping accurate staff records; managing workflows and change control; and preparing reports and charts.
